On the harder days tell yourself…

Here are some things to remember on the harder days, if anything here resonates with you, you are welcome to reach out for support.

  • I will keep noticing the small things that bring me joy.
  • I will remember to check in with myself regularly – how is my breath, body, where are my thoughts wondering?
  • If or when my thoughts wonder off somewhere unsafe, I can always bring my thoughts back to this present moment where I am safe. Sometimes it takes practice, I have done it before and can do it again. It is okay for thoughts to wonder, when I notice, I can gently bring them back without judgement and anchor in my safe space.
  • I am allowed to feel grateful for things in my life.
  • I am allowed to rest as often as my body needs; I do not need to earn rest.
  • I will give myself permission to feel my feelings.
  • I can re-arrange my schedule, wherever possible to meet my OWN needs, this is OKAY, each day I may feel differently.
  • I am able to remember and protect the boundaries I have created for my own wellbeing.
  • I am allowed to and deserve to be kind to myself.

You are allowed to look after yourself.
